    Jellyfin setup and running - but am I missing something?

    Looking for next step after initial setup and basic customisation.

    I've moved from Plex to Jellyfin in docker on my NAS, and everything has been running great for the past month. The forums and the old reddit threads have been very helpful to get everything set up. Transcode/Plugins/Prerolls/Trailers are all working as I expect.

    I'm now on the next steps on the customisation path, but it does feel like there is a gap in the 'intermediate' stage and I am wondering if Im missing something in the setup process.

    For example;

    I want to re-order my Libraries on my Admin dashboard, and documentation points towards this being possible in config files, but the file path instructions don't seem to align with the folders created by the docker container. How do I get to config to possibly adjust this order?

    I was also looking for the web client files location to understand configuration options change logos etc and to help me see what I could tinker with some custom CSS possibly. (I set up a local config.json for that customisation option and was looking at the web client repository).

    I can see the path in Jellyfin client jellyfin/jellyfin-web but this doesn't seem to correlate with anything I've set up. I even went into the container terminal looking for directories, but had no luck. Where is this pointing?

    I did read a guide on creating a local version of the web client, is this the logical next step?
